Archdeacon of Teviotdale
The Archdeacon of Teviotdale was the head of the
Teviotdale region of the Scottish Borders region. The position was an important position within the medieval Scottish church; because of the high number of parish churches
in the archdeaconry.
List of archdeacons of Teviotdale
- Peter de Alinton 1238–1242
- Reginald de Irvine 1242–1245
- Nicholas de Moffat, 1245–1270[1]
- William Wishart, 1288–1297 x 1308[2]
- Roger de Welleton, 1307–1310
- William de Hillum, 1312
- William de Yetholm 1320 x 1321–1329
- John de Berwick, x 1354
- John de Boulton, 1354
- Henry de Smalham, 1354–1358 x 1364
- John de Ancrum, 1364–1393
- Thomas de "Mathane", 1394
- John de Merton, 1394–1400 x 1404
- John Forrester, 1418
- William Croyser, 1418–1440 x 1443; 1446 x 1451–1460 x 1461
- John de Scheves, 1418–1419
- John Lyon, 1418–1418 x 1423
- Edward de Lauder, x 1419
- Alexander de Foulertoun, 1422 x 1424
- John Bowmaker, x 1424–1428
- Andrew de Hawick, 1424–1425
- John Benyng, 1426
- William Croyser
- James Croyser, 1440
- Walter Blair, 1441–1447
- Patrick Hume, 1443–1472
- Alexander Inglis, 1471
- John Lichton, 1472
- David Luthirdale, 1474–1475
- John Whitelaw, 1475
- Nicholas Forman, 1478 x 1479
- James Doles, 1478
- John Brown, 1479
- William Elphinstone junior, 1479–1481[3]
- William Elphinstone senior, 1481 x 1482–1486
- John Martini, 1486 x 1491 (?), x 1510
- William Ker, 1491,1510–1511
- George'Berber', 1509
- George Lockhart, 1509 x 1520–1533
- Thomas Ker, x 1534
- John Lauder, 1534–1551
- John Hepburn, 1544–1564 x 1565
- Robert Richardson, 1552–1565
- Thomas Ker, 1565–1569
